Transaction 82754c646122300cc0c79f914f29fe4106c7c40efc7a63fe873478731f9b8c0b

1 Input
2 Outputs
  • 82754c646122300cc0c79f914f29fe4106c7c40efc7a63fe873478731f9b8c0b:0
  • value  350000
    address  3Hq886kkAYX6ELrQsL5ooNSiMkPMPMABYw
  • 82754c646122300cc0c79f914f29fe4106c7c40efc7a63fe873478731f9b8c0b:1
  • value  1631387
    address  1LqaafUtQrptoExT1p8KYpGhUbUP4tont4